The Power of Connectivity

In today's digital age, social media has become integral to our daily lives. It's a virtual space where connections are made, information is shared, and opportunities abound. For actors, tapping into this vast network of connectivity can significantly enhance their chances of landing roles and advancing their careers.


By following casting directors on social media, actors gain direct access to valuable insights and updates about upcoming projects, casting calls, and industry trends. This insider knowledge gives them a competitive edge, allowing them to stay ahead of the curve and tailor their auditions to align with the casting director's vision.

Building Relationships

Beyond just being a source of information, social media provides a unique platform for actors to build meaningful relationships with casting directors. By engaging with their posts, sharing relevant content, and showcasing their talent through videos or portfolios, actors can create a lasting impression that goes beyond the confines of a traditional audition room.


Casting directors are constantly looking for fresh talent, and social media offers them a convenient way to discover new faces and voices. By maintaining a professional and engaging presence online, actors increase their visibility and make it easier for casting directors to find them when the right opportunity arises.

Demonstrating Professionalism

In addition to showcasing their talent, social media allows actors to demonstrate their professionalism and dedication to their craft. By curating a polished and cohesive online presence, complete with a professional headshot, a well-crafted bio, and a portfolio of their work, actors convey a sense of reliability and commitment that casting directors appreciate.


Furthermore, by engaging in meaningful conversations, offering insights into their creative process, and sharing their experiences within the industry, actors can establish themselves as valuable assets worth considering for future projects.

Staying Informed

In an industry as fast-paced and ever-changing as acting, staying informed is critical to staying relevant. By following casting directors on social media, actors gain access to real-time updates and industry news that can shape their career decisions and inform their next steps.


Whether it's learning about casting opportunities, industry events, or emerging trends, staying informed keeps actors one step ahead and ensures they're always ready to seize the next big opportunity.

Leveraging Social Proof

In the world of casting, social proof can play a significant role in decision-making. When casting directors see that an actor has a strong following on social media, engages with their audience, and receives positive feedback from peers and fans alike, it adds credibility to their talent. It makes them a more attractive choice for roles.


By actively building their social media presence and cultivating a loyal following, actors increase their visibility and enhance their perceived value in the eyes of casting directors and industry professionals.
